Swords of Revealing Light holds a distinct place in the history of the Yu-Gi-Oh! Trading Card Game, appearing as card SDBE-EN031 in the 2013 Saga of Blue-Eyes White Dragon Structure Deck. Released by Konami, this product line was designed to help players build competitive decks centered around the legendary Blue-Eyes White Dragon archetype. For collectors, this card serves as a foundational piece of that era's gameplay history. As a Common rarity card within the SDBE set, Swords of Revealing Light is accessible yet highly sought after by enthusiasts looking to complete their set collections. It represents a key moment in the game’s mechanical evolution, offering strategic depth that defined many early duels. Collectors often seek out this card not just for its utility, but for its connection to the beloved Blue-Eyes theme that has captivated fans for decades. This card remains a recognizable and important part of any serious Yu-Gi-Oh! Collection, bridging the gap between casual play and competitive strategy.

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
After this card's activation, it remains on the field, but you must destroy it during the End Phase of your opponent's 3rd turn. When this card is activated: If your opponent controls a face-down monster, flip all monsters they control face-up. While this card is face-up on the field, your opponent's monsters cannot declare an attack.
